Added test for memsrch subroutine.
[vvhitespace] / stdlib_tests / 2006_memsrch.pvvs
CommitLineData
096fa8e2
AT
1@ Push '42' onto heap[32]-heap[33].
2SSSTSTSTSN | PUSH 42 (pattern)
3SSSTSSSSSN | PUSH 32 (address)
4SSSTN | PUSH 1 (count)
5NSTTTSSSN | JSR > 11000 (memset)
6
7@ This comparison should return true.
8SSSTSTSTSN | PUSH 42 (pattern)
9SSSTSSSN | PUSH 8 (count)
10SSSSTTTSSN | PUSH 28 (address)
11NSTTTTSSN | JSR > 11100 (memsrch)
12
13NSTTSSTN | JSR > 1001 (print number from stack)
14
15NNN | DIE
16
17#include <heap.pvvs>
18#include <stdio.pvvs>